Transaction 83d425b25ce24fc044221c70cc4daeb112d9aa305d38b9ef92b4d194173d5235
1 Input
1 Output
-
83d425b25ce24fc044221c70cc4daeb112d9aa305d38b9ef92b4d194173d5235:0
- value
- 27059168
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5dceeeb8cf14a9d8d48e10fc9eafc5a9ea65b834 OP_EQUAL
- address
- 3AF2fJjsJf4w21Ya2MY1rgBZMVHDaqKxCD